Small bathroom remodeling services focus on updating and improving compact bathroom spaces to better meet the needs of homeowners. This type of work often involves replacing outdated fixtures, upgrading cabinetry, installing new flooring, and refreshing paint or wall treatments. The goal is to maximize functionality and enhance the overall appearance of a small bathroom, making it more comfortable and visually appealing without requiring a complete overhaul of the entire space. Local contractors experienced in small bathroom remodels can help transform these often tight areas into more efficient and attractive parts of a home.

Many homeowners seek small bathroom remodeling services to address common problems such as cramped layouts, outdated fixtures, or insufficient storage. A small bathroom that feels cluttered or poorly designed can impact daily routines and overall satisfaction with the space. Remodeling can help solve these issues by reconfiguring the layout, adding clever storage solutions, or installing modern fixtures that save space. Additionally, a remodel can improve accessibility for those with mobility challenges or simply make the bathroom easier to clean and maintain, contributing to a more functional and user-friendly environment.

The overview below groups typical Small Bathroom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Piscataway,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or bathroom updates, such as replacing fixtures or re-grouting,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all into this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um. Local contractors can often complete these quickly and affordably.

Partial Remodels - For mid-sized projects like updating vanities, flooring, or lighting, costs usually range from $1,500-$4,000. These projects are common and often involve replacing key components without a full tear-out. Larger, more complex jobs can exceed this range but are less frequent.

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ete remodels that include tearing out and rebuilding a bathroom typically cost between $5,000-$10,000. Many projects fall within this range, though larger or high-end upgrades can go beyond $12,000. Local pros can help tailor the scope to fit different budgets.

Luxury or Custom Projects - High-end, custom bathroom remodels with premium fixtures, custom cabinetry, and specialty features can easily reach $15,000 or more. These are less common and represent the upper tier of remodeling costs, often involving intricate design and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common updates included in small bathroom remodeling? Typical updates may include replacing fixtures, updating tile and flooring, installing new vanities, and improving lighting to enhance functionality and appearance.

Can small bathroom remodeling improve storage space? Yes, many service providers can add or optimize storage solutions such as cabinets, shelves, or built-in niches to maximize space efficiency.

Are there design options suitable for limited bathroom space? Local contractors often offer design ideas that utilize compact fixtures, clever layouts, and space-saving accessories to make small bathrooms feel more open.

What materials are commonly used in small bathroom remodels? Durable and moisture-resistant materials like ceramic or porcelain tiles, waterproof paints, and quality fixtures are frequently chosen for small spaces.
